The NIKKOR Z 180-600mm f/5.6-6.3 VR takes you far beyond the reach of standard and telephoto zoom lenses, making the most distant shots suddenly possible.
Powerful 180mm-600mm range.
At its widest setting, the NIKKOR Z 180-600mm f/5.6-6.3 VR is great for locating your subject. With a mere quarter turn of the zoom ring, you can reach all the way to 600mm for tight framing with beautiful background compression.
Comfortable handheld shooting.
The NIKKOR Z 180-600mm f/5.6-6.3 VR is among the lightest super-telephoto zoom lenses in its class*, and since it doesn’t expand/retract, it handles the same at every zoom position.
*According to Nikon research of comparable full-frame mirrorless lenses as of June, 2023.
Short-throw internal zoom.
An all-internal design eliminates extending/retracting, improving handling, with only a 70° turn needed to go from 180mm to 600mm. The design also prevents dust or moisture from entering those moving parts.
Versatile close focusing.
With a minimum focus distance of just 4.27 ft at the 180mm zoom position and a large 0.25x reproduction ratio, you can turn an unexpected close encounter into a once-in-a-lifetime photo or video.
Up to 5.5 stops of VR.
Built-in optical Vibration Reduction (VR) provides a stabilization effect equivalent to a shutter speed of 5.5 stops* faster, reducing camera blur when panning to track fast-moving subjects.
*Based on CIPA Standard; in [Normal] mode at the telephoto end when attached to a full-frame/FX-format camera.
Sharp in low light.
Built-in optical VR image stabilization also allows you to shoot at slower shutter speeds to gather more light at dusk, dawn or in a dense forest.
Quiet, accurate autofocus.
Reliably track your subjects without mechanical lens noise, crucial for skittish wildlife and video recording.
Pairs great with Z teleconverters.
Increase your reach by 2x (up to 1200mm) or 1.4x (up to 840mm) with Nikon’s Z series teleconverters (sold separately).

Mount Type | Nikon Z Mount |
Focal Length Range | 180 - 600mm |
Zoom Ratio | 3.33x |
Maximum Aperture | f/ 5.6-6.3 |
Minimum Aperture | f/ 32-36 |
Aperture Range |
180mm zoom position: f/5.6 - 32 600mm zoom position: f/6.3 - 36 The value displayed at minimum aperture may vary with the exposure increment selected on the camera. |
Format | FX |
Maximum Angle of View (DX-format) | 9° to 2° 40' |
Maximum Angle of View (FX-format) | 13° 40' to 4° 10' |
Maximum Reproduction Ratio | 0.25x |
Lens Elements | 25 |
Lens Groups | 17 |
VR (Vibration Reduction) Image Stabilization | Off, Normal, Sport |
Diaphragm Blades | 9 Rounded diaphragm opening |
ED Glass Elements | 6 |
Aspherical Elements | 1 |
Fluorine Coat | Yes |
Autofocus | Yes |
AF Actuator | STM (stepping motor) |
Internal Focusing | Yes |
Minimum Focus Distance |
180mm zoom position: 4.27 ft (1.3 m) measured from focal plane 200mm zoom position: 4.47 ft (1.36 m) measured from focal plane 300mm zoom position: 5.48 ft (1.67 m) measured from focal plane 400mm zoom position: 6.37 ft (1.94 m) measured from focal plane 500mm zoom position: 7.19 ft (2.19 m) measured from focal plane 600mm zoom position: 7.88 ft (2.4 m) measured from focal plane |
Focus Mode | Manual/Auto |
Focus Limit Switch | Two positions: FULL (8 to 1.3 m) and ininfity to 6 m |
Filter Size |
95mm (P = 1.0 mm) |
Accepts Filter Type | Front: screw-in |
Approx. Dimensions (Diameter x Length) |
4.4 in. (110 mm) x 12.5 in. (315.5 mm) Distance to end of lens from camera lens mount flange Based on CIPA guidelines |
Approx. Weight |
68.96 oz. (1955 g) Based on CIPA guidelines Without tripod collar. |
